# Major Recall Alert: Publix Rice & Pigeon Peas (Net Wt 32 oz) Recalled Due to Undeclared Allergen (Soy)

If you recently purchased Publix Rice & Pigeon Peas, Net Wt 32 oz (2lb), it’s time to check your pantry. ASK Foods Inc has issued a recall on this product due to an undeclared soy allergen. The recall involves products packaged in a plastic tray with a clear lid, black film, and a pre-printed label. Six (2lb) containers are included in each case. Consumers with soy allergies are urged to take action immediately.

## Why This Recall is Important

Food allergen recalls are not something to take lightly. Soy, a common allergen, can cause severe allergic reactions, including breathing issues, swelling, digestive problems, and even life-threatening anaphylaxis in sensitive individuals. Since soy was not listed on the product’s label, consumers who unknowingly consume it may be at serious health risk.

ASK Foods Inc issued this recall as a safety measure to protect its customers. It’s vital for all consumers, especially those with soy allergies or sensitivities, to stay informed about this development to prevent potential health complications.

### Details of the Recall

Below is an overview of the recalled product:

- **Brand**: ASK Foods Inc
- **Product Name**: Publix Rice & Pigeon Peas
- **Packaging**: Plastic tray with a clear lid, black film, and pre-printed labels.
- **Net Weight**: 32 oz (2lb) per container
- **Quantity Per Case**: Six (6) containers
- **Recall Reason**: Undeclared soy allergen
- **Announcement Date**: October 2023

### What You Should Do

If you believe you have purchased the affected Publix Rice & Pigeon Peas, follow these steps to ensure your safety:

- **Check your packaging**: Confirm that your product matches the recall details above, including the packaging and labeling.
- **Stop consumption immediately**: Do not eat the product, especially if you or someone in your family has a soy allergy.
- **Dispose of the product safely**: If you identify the product as part of the recall, discard it immediately.
- **Contact your retailer**: Check with the store where you purchased the product to inquire about refunds or exchanges.

For additional concerns, contact ASK Foods Inc for further instructions on handling the recalled item. Keeping a clear record of the purchase, such as receipts or product photos, may be helpful.
